How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Mechanical Maintenance Engineer

    Mechanical Maintenance Engineer. We are looking for an experienced Mechanical Maintenance Engineer to join a well - established and growing building services company, covering the London area.

    This is a hands-on position carrying out planned and reactive maintenance across a range of mechanical building services and M&E systems. You'll be responsible for fault finding, servicing and maintaining mechanical plant while ensuring work is completed safely, efficiently and to a high standard.

    The Role

    As a Mechanical Maintenance Engineer, your responsibilities will include:

    Carrying out planned preventative maintenance (PPM) and reactive maintenance
    Servicing and maintaining mechanical plant and building services equipment
    Fault finding and diagnosing mechanical issues
    Servicing pumps and pressurisation units
    Carrying out routine service inspections in accordance with PPM schedules
    Responding to breakdowns and call-outs
    Identifying faults and completing necessary remedial works
    Producing reports and relevant certification
    Completing and maintaining site logbooks
    Ensuring work complies with Health & Safety requirements and risk assessments
    Liaising with customers and tenants while on site
    Supporting small works and projects where required
    Minimising repeat visits through effective fault diagnosis and repairWhat We're Looking For

    You should have previous experience working within mechanical building services, facilities management or an M&E maintenance environment.

    Ideally, you will have:

    Relevant mechanical engineering qualifications
    Experience maintaining mechanical M&E systems
    Strong mechanical fault-finding skills
    Experience carrying out PPM and reactive maintenance
    Experience servicing pumps and pressurisation units
    Good understanding of Health & Safety requirements
    Ability to work independently and manage your own workload
    Good communication and customer service skills
    Flexibility to undertake occasional out-of-hours and weekend workWhat's on Offer?

    £35,000 - £50,000 OTE depending on experience
    Company van or travel expenses
    Overtime opportunities
    Company phone
    Uniform provided
    20 days holiday, increasing with service + bank holidays
